Although "selling out" has a proper meaning, I think it is typically applied to bands that people don't like. In one sense, it is impossible for a commercial band to sell out, since the point of putting out a CD or download or whatever with a price tag on it is to make money. Many people seem to forget that, and imagine that somehow their favored band is "pure" and is doing what they are doing irrespective of money. But anything with a price tag on it is about money. It may also be about other things, too, but it is about money regardless of whether it is about anything else.
